Item 5.02.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.
On May 3, 2022, Ernest R. Bates, who previously served as Senior Vice President of Sales and Business Development, International Operations of American Shared Hospital Services (the “Company”), was transitioned to Vice President of International Sales and Marketing. In this position, Mr. Bates will report directly to the Vice President of Sales and Marketing.

American Shared Hospital Services Expands Sales Team
Fills New Senior Sales Management Position with Healthcare Finance Pro, Tim Keel
SAN FRANCISCO, CA, May 6, 2022 ‒ American Shared Hospital Services (NYSE American: AMS) (the "Company” or “AMS"), a leading provider of turnkey technology solutions for stereotactic radiosurgery and advanced radiation therapy equipment and services, today announced that it has expanded the Company’s sales team by hiring Timothy J. Keel as Vice President of Sales and Marketing, responsible for sales and marketing company-wide, effective May 3, 2022. Ernest R. Bates will become Vice President of International Sales and Marketing.
Timothy J. Keel has over 30 years of experience in the healthcare finance sector. He previously served as Vice President of Sales for Dext Capital, a leading independent Healthcare finance company. Prior to Dext, he held several senior sales roles at BankAmerica, Citibank and Key Bank with a focus in project finance in oncology, outpatient surgery and diagnostic imaging. Mr. Keel holds a Bachelor of Science in Financial Management from California State University of Long Beach.

About American Shared Hospital Services (NYSE American: AMS)
American Shared Hospital Services is a leading provider of turnkey technology solutions for stereotactic radiosurgery and advanced radiation therapy equipment and services. AMS is a leading provider in providing Gamma Knife radiosurgery equipment, a non-invasive treatment for malignant and benign brain tumors, vascular malformations, and trigeminal neuralgia (facial pain). The Company also offers proton therapy, and the latest IGRT, IMRT and MR/LINAC systems. For more information, please visit: www.ashs.com.
